Output faa66f12a38291a497d595017c972a7d30be356980d7828c2bfec672443a73b3:32

value
10596818
script pubkey
OP_0 OP_PUSHBYTES_20 73df5e8bf03d1b1f03f29c789cae59a7c8d98f06
address
bc1qw004azls85d37qljn3ufetje5lydnrcxf978uc
transaction
faa66f12a38291a497d595017c972a7d30be356980d7828c2bfec672443a73b3